The best albums of 2020 (update February 29)

The numbers presented next to each album title are the weighted average rating, and, in brackets, average and number of ratings (out of 34 included sources). The weighted average is based on a formula that includes a) the average of ratings and b) the number of sources that have rated the album.

The magazines I used for the ratings were:
EUR + Australia: Gaffa-dk; Gaffa-sw; Humo; Indiestyle; Jenesaispop; Laut; Mondosonoro; Musikexpress; Nojesguiden; Ondarock; Plattentests; Sentire Ascoltare; The Music
UK: Clash; DIY; God Is In The Tv; Load And Quiet; Music OMH; The Guardian; The Line Of Best Fit; The Skinny
USA + Canada: Allmusic; Consequence Of Sound; Earbuddy; Exclaim!; Nothern Transmissions; Paste; Pitchfork; Popmatters; Rolling Stone; Spectrum Culture; Under The Radar
